Bobcats knock off top-ranked Rapids

The Brookswood Bobcats navigated the Riverside Rapids to take top spot at the prestigious Top Ten Shootout.

The Bobcats defeated the Rapids — the top-ranked AAA senior girls basketball team in the province — 68-63 in the championship final at Coquitlam’s Centennial Secondary.

Luca Schmidt earned the tournament’s most valuable player award while Lindsay Wand was a first team all-star.

The ’Cats entered the tournament ranked fourth in the province.

In the team’s other games, they opened with a 78-38 win over Kitsilano, beat Maple Ridge 84-64 and then edged Oak Bay 54-49 in the semifinals.

Oak Bay is ranked second in the province and Maple Ridge fifth.
